This analysis shows that incidence does indeed increase significantly with dose, the difference between the slope of the regression line and zero being significant at the 1% level. Most centres do not report on the laterality of tumours. However, analysis of data from those centres that do report later- ality (Table 2 and Figure 2) shows no significant increase in the incidence of bilateral tumours with annual ambient UV dose, but a highly significant one in the case of unilateral tumours.
